The best loot system I've encountered in an MMO so far is DDO's. There is a chest after each boss fight and everyone has their own loot table. No ninja'ing is possible, no stress over loot, everyone is happy. The second best was WAR's, which had loot bags that were rolled for based on a person's contribution to the encounter. The problem was that you could disable this feature in guilds and, guess what, people abused the hell out of it.
Wow needs to come up with something like DDO. Whenever loot distribution comes up, some people argue that they are in the super-mega happy type guilds where no one has ever had a loot problem ever, ever , ever...but those are rare (or total BS). If there is even the slightest chance a loot system can be abused people will do it. Remove the ability for players to control the loot of other players and you increase the fun by like a million percent. As it stands, the WoW system is forever doomed to being the fuel for misery.
